When to use date and time in Salesforce apex?

Always be sure to use the Date and Time types in Apex and the Date and Time fields on sObjects if you only need to store a date or a time. Another case where you would want to use separate Date and Time objects or fields is when representing an event that takes place at a certain local time in more than one place.


How does Salesforce calculate date difference?

To find the difference between two Date values as a number, subtract one from the other like so: date_1 — date_2 to return the difference in days.

How are dates formatted in Salesforce?

Date and Time Stored in Salesforce Salesforce uses the ISO8601 format YYYY-MM-DDThh:mm:ss.SZ for date/time fields, which stores date/time in UTC. Assuming a user is in the en-US locale and Pacific time zone, here are two examples for a date field with the value 1965-04-09 .


How do you compare a timestamp?

When comparing two TIMESTAMP WITH TIME ZONE values, the comparison is made using the UTC representations of the values. Two TIMESTAMP WITH TIME ZONE values are considered equal if they represent the same instance in UTC, regardless of the time zone offsets that are stored in the values. How do I extract date from datetime in Salesforce?

Use the DATEVALUE( date/time ) function to return the Date value of a Date/Time. For example, to get the year from a Date/Time, use YEAR( DATEVALUE( date/time ) ) ) . You can convert a Date value to a Date/Time using the DATETIMEVALUE( date ) function.

How does Salesforce store dates?

We know the datetime is converted to UTC format and stored in salesforce backend. Is this same to date field as well ie: date is converted to UTC and stored or it is stored as it is. Any help highly appreciated. Dates are stored as UTC values in GMT time zome.


Can we change the date format in Salesforce?

Date formatting is a function of the “Locale” field on the user record. You can set an org-wide default in Company Information but each user can change their own as desired. If you use a English (Canada) or English (United Kingdom) it should display the date format to what you’re looking for.

What is createddate field?

Some fields, such as CreatedDate, are Date/Time fields, meaning they not only store a date value, but also a time value (stored in GMT but displayed in the users’ time zone). Date, Date/Time, and Time fields are formatted in the user’s locale when viewed in reports and record detail pages.

What is the timenow function?

The TIMENOW () function returns a value in GMT representing the current time without the date. Use this function instead of the NOW () function if you want the current hour, minute, seconds, or milliseconds. This value is useful for tracking time like work shifts or elapsed time,


Why is subtracting a date from another date not a problem?

Subtracting a standard Date/Time field from another isn’t a problem because both fields are in the same time zone. When one of the values in the calculation is a conversion from a Text or Date value to a Date/Time value, however, the results are different.

What data type is used to track time?

Two data types are used for working with dates: Date and Date/Time. One data type, Time, is independent of the date for tracking time such as business hours. Most values that are used when working with dates are of the Date data type, which store the year, month, and day. Some fields, such as CreatedDate, are Date/Time fields, …

When to use separate date and time fields?

Another case where you would want to use separate Date and Time objects or fields is when representing an event that takes place at a certain local time in more than one place. For example, if you want to store a deadline to submit documentation on February 1, 2019 at 5:00 PM no matter where you are (your team in New York submits at 5:00 PM Eastern Time and you team in Los Angeles submits at 5:00 PM Pacific Time), you would want to use separate date and time fields.


Why does Apex use GMT?

Similar to how it doesn’t matter when we stored our distance as millimeters when we wanted to work with meters, it doesn’t matter that we store our DateTime as GMT, because all we want is to store a specific moment in time. It’s actually better that we use a consistent model to store our DateTime records.


When did DST start in 2007?

But in 2005, the US announces that DST in 2007 would begin on March 11 instead of April 1. Suddenly, March 20, 2008 03:00 PM GMT, which is the GMT date you have saved, doesn’t translate to March 20, 2008 09:00 AM in America/Chicago anymore.


Why use offset time zone?

Using an offset-based time zone for display makes sense because it removes the ambiguity associated with region-based time zones. November 3, 2019 at 01:30 AM appears twice in America/Los_Angeles but when displaying the two instances, adding PST or PDT can resolve that ambiguity.

Does Apex support time zones?

The official documentation says that Apex supports all time zones returned by TimeZone.getAvailableIDs method in Java. Where does Java get this list from? Currently, Java gets this from the tz database which is an ICANN-backed collabarative effort to maintain a list of all time zones. Since governments can redefine time zones any time, the database is constantly updated.


Can Salesforce save datetimes in GMT?

A good solution to deal with situations like these would be to persist future DateTimes representing a particular local time in the local time zone, but unfortunately Salesforce only allows us to save DateTimes in GMT. We could talk about saving a local DateTime as a Date, Time and a String Timezone field, but the added complication and the lack of ability in Apex to directly construct a DateTime from data in any given timezone (I intend to write a blog on how to do this later), it might not be worth it.


How long does Salesforce evaluate pending actions?

All pending actions are evaluated only for as long as the rule criteria is true. While Salesforce evaluates the rule every time the record is updated, it does not trigger all the actions associated with the rule every time.


When is the time dependent action scheduled?

If a record matching the criteria is created on July 1st and the Close Date is set to July 30th, the time-dependent action is scheduled for July 23rd. However, if the Opportunity is set to “Closed Won” or “Closed Lost” before July 23rd, the time-dependent action is automatically removed from the queue.


What happens if you update a record that matches both rules?

If you create a record that matches both rules, Salesforce executes the immediate actions and queues the time-dependent actions of both rules. If you then update the record and it no longer meets the rule criteria, Salesforce removes the pending actions for both rules. If you then update the record so it meets the rule criteria again, Salesforce only executes the actions associated with Rule 2.


What happens when you create an Opportunity Reminder Rule?

Example: When you create an Opportunity reminder rule, it doesn’t run against existing Opportunities. The new rule only applies to records created or updated after the rule is activated.

Does Salesforce recalculate time triggers?

Salesforce recalculates the time trigger as long as the time trigger has not yet fired and the recalculation does not reschedule the time trigger to a date in the past .

5. Where does Salesforce operate around the world?

Salesforce operates in 84 cities, with 110 offices around the world. There are eight Salesforce Towers currently (in Atlanta, Dublin, Indianapolis, London, New York, Paris, San Francisco, and Tokyo) with another two in development (Salesforce Tower Sydney and Salesforce Tower Chicago).


6. How tall is the Salesforce tower in San Francisco?

1,070 feet. Opened in 2018, the Salesforce Tower in San Francisco is 61 stories and 1.4 million square feet of office space.

8. How much has Salesforce spent to ensure equality in employee salaries?

Salesforce has spent $16 million to date to ensure equal pay for equal work among its global workforce. In 2015, the company committed to investigating and addressing any gender pay gaps.


9. How is Salesforce a sustainable company?

In 2021, Salesforce achieved net zero across its full value chain and reached 100% renewable energy. This means Salesforce has purchased enough renewable energy to match all electricity it uses globally.
